#include <Adafruit_GFX.h>
#include <Adafruit_SSD1306.h>
#include <DHT.h>
#define SCREEN_WIDTH 128
#define SCREEN_HEIGHT 64
#define OLED_RESET -1
#define DHTPIN 15 // Changed to GPIO 15
#define DHTTYPE DHT22 // Sử dụng cảm biến độ ẩm DHT22
Adafruit_SSD1306 display(SCREEN_WIDTH, SCREEN_HEIGHT, &Wire, OLED_RESET);
DHT dht(DHTPIN, DHTTYPE);
void setup() {
Wire.begin(21, 22); // SDA = 21, SCL = 22
Serial.begin(115200);
if (!display.begin(SSD1306_SWITCHCAPVCC, 0x3C)) {
Serial.println(F("SSD1306 allocation failed"));
while (true);
}
dht.begin();
delay(2000); // Chờ cảm biến độ ẩm
display.clearDisplay();
display.setTextSize(1);
display.setTextColor(WHITE);
display.setCursor(0, 0);
display.println("DHT22");
display.display();
}
void loop() {
float temperature = dht.readTemperature();
float humidity = dht.readHumidity();
if (isnan(temperature) || isnan(humidity)) {
Serial.println("Failed to read from DHT sensor!");
display.clearDisplay();
display.setTextSize(1);
display.setCursor(0, 0);
display.println("DHT ERROR");
display.display();
} else {
Serial.println("Temperature: " + String(temperature));
Serial.println("Humidity: " + String(humidity));
display.clearDisplay();
display.setTextSize(1);
display.setCursor(0, 0);
display.println("Temp: " + String(temperature) + " C");
display.setCursor(0, 10);
display.println("Humid: " + String(humidity) + " %");
display.display();
}
delay(2000);
}
